How could prediction lead to better economic decision making
Scrat [10]

Explanation:  Prediction is an integral and essential part of the economy, because it can gain insight into market conditions in the immediate, near or further future. This is of course done on the basis of many economic indicators and probabilities arising from previous market experience and other economic parameters. This does not mean that the prediction will always prove to be true, or at least in the highest percentage true, but that is why it is called prediction. In any case, experienced economists know how to predict market conditions and make decisions on how, where, what to invest, what will make the best profit, etc. It also implies in what order to invest, what monetary policy should look like. In a word, forecasting can contribute to better economic decision making in order to maximize profits.

How did president harry truman react to the north korean invasion of south korea? answers?
Reptile [31]
<span> President Truman ordered the U.S air and naval forces to moved from Japan to South Korea to enforce a United Nations resolution for the war to end, and to stop the communism to spread in Asia. Truman also deployed the U.S Fleet to Taiwan to guard against invasion of China.<span>
